在科技飞速发展的今天,无人驾驶汽车已经成为了一个热门的话题。它不仅代表了未来交通出行的新方式,更是人工智能领域的一大突破。本文将深入探讨无人驾驶的核心技术,包括算法基础以及未来发展趋势。
算法基础:感知、决策与控制
感知
感知是无人驾驶汽车获取周围环境信息的过程,主要包括以下几种技术:
- 激光雷达(LiDAR):通过发射激光束并接收反射回来的光,构建周围环境的3D模型。激光雷达具有高精度、高分辨率的特点,是目前无人驾驶感知领域的主流技术。
- 摄像头:利用摄像头捕捉图像信息,通过图像处理技术识别道路、车辆、行人等物体。摄像头具有成本低、易于部署的优点,但受光线、天气等因素影响较大。
- 毫米波雷达:通过发射毫米波信号并接收反射回来的信号,检测周围物体的距离、速度等信息。毫米波雷达具有较强的穿透能力,适用于恶劣天气条件。
决策
决策是无人驾驶汽车根据感知到的环境信息,做出行驶决策的过程。主要包括以下几种算法:
- 基于规则的方法:通过预设的规则,对环境进行判断并做出决策。这种方法简单易行,但难以应对复杂多变的路况。
- 基于模型的方法:通过建立环境模型,对周围环境进行预测并做出决策。这种方法需要大量的数据支持,且模型复杂度较高。
- 基于深度学习的方法:利用深度学习技术,对环境进行感知和决策。这种方法具有较好的泛化能力,但需要大量的训练数据。
控制
控制是无人驾驶汽车根据决策结果,控制车辆行驶的过程。主要包括以下几种技术:
- PID控制:通过调整比例、积分、微分参数,实现对车辆速度、转向等参数的控制。PID控制简单易行,但难以应对复杂多变的路况。
- 模型预测控制(MPC):通过建立车辆动力学模型,预测未来一段时间内的行驶轨迹,并优化控制策略。MPC控制精度较高,但计算复杂度较高。
- 自适应控制:根据车辆行驶过程中的实时信息,调整控制策略。自适应控制具有较强的适应能力,但需要大量的实验数据支持。
未来趋势
高度自动化
随着技术的不断发展,无人驾驶汽车的自动化程度将越来越高。未来,无人驾驶汽车将实现完全自动驾驶,无需人工干预。
智能化
无人驾驶汽车将具备更强的智能化能力,能够适应更加复杂多变的路况。例如,通过学习人类司机的驾驶习惯,实现更加人性化的驾驶体验。
安全性
安全性是无人驾驶汽车发展的关键。未来,无人驾驶汽车将采用更加先进的安全技术,确保行车安全。
跨界融合
无人驾驶汽车将与其他领域(如物联网、云计算等)进行跨界融合,为人们提供更加便捷、智能的出行体验。
总之,无人驾驶汽车的发展前景广阔。随着技术的不断进步,无人驾驶汽车将逐渐走进我们的生活,为人类带来更加美好的未来。
